The 123rd edition of Durand Cup Football Tournament begins today in New Delhi. Chairman of the Standing Working Committee, Durand Football Tournament Society, Maj Gen Manvender Singh said that 18 teams are participating in the tournament which will be conducted in two stages, Qualifying Knock-out Rounds and the Quarter Final League, starting from October 27th.Sixteen teams have been accommodated in the qualifying knock out rounds. They are – four teams from the Army, one team each from Indian Navy and Air Force, two teams from paramilitary forces BSF and Assam Rifles, Uttarakhand Police besides Ahbab Sports Club, J&K Bank, Srinagar, Garhwal Heroes, Tata Football Club, Indian National Football Club, Vasco and Amity United from Haryana. They will be divided into two groups of eight teams each. Winner of each group will be promoted to quarter final league.Ten teams are directly seeded in the quarter final league. They are – Churchill Brothers, Dempo Sports Club, Sporting Club-de-Goa, East Bengal Club, JCT Phagwara, Air India Mumbai, Salgaocar Sports Club, Pune Football Club, Army Red and Chirag United. Two winner teams from the qualifying knockout rounds will join to make the tally of twelve teams for the Quarter Final round.These teams will be divided into four groups of three teams each. Winner of each group will qualify for semi-finals. All matches of the Tournament have been thrown open to the public without tickets on first come first serve basis. The sporting extravaganza will conclude on November 7th. The Durand Football Tournament has the distinction of being the third oldest Football Tournament of the world and the oldest Football Tournament of Asia.
